Garner
CategoryArchaic Word / Agricultural Term
Modern Equivalenta granary; a barn for storing grain; to gather and store.
KJV Word TypeNoun / Verb
DefinitionA storehouse or granary where threshed grain is kept. As a verb, to garner means to gather and store. In the NT it is used by John the Baptist to describe Christ's end-time gathering of the righteous as wheat into His garner.
Key Verses"He will throughly purge his floor, and gather his wheat into the garner; but he will burn up the chaff with unquenchable fire." (Matthew 3:12)
